  • Most of the major aspects of the high speed rail tunnels in Korea, including such items as the tunnel geometry, excavation methods, primary support, final lining, drainage and waterproofing, are similar to the practices followed in other countries. The tunnels in Korea provide the largest net internal area $(107\;m^2)$ as compared to the other counties addressed in this paper. The effective adaptation and modification of international practices and designs, combined with the integration of domestic practices, has resulted in the successful construction of these large tunnels. The experience gained from the completed work to date on the high speed line in Korea, combined with international technology input, will help to ensure future tunnels are constructed in an efficient manner with adequate design measures implemented for the long-term operational life of the tunnels. As has occurred in these other countries, further improvements and modifications to the Korea high-speed railway tunnels will occur as experience is gained and new technology develops.

  • The purpose of this study is is to organize the site-plan types of common design's Goon office buildings in Japanese colonial period based on the main building's shape and main & attached building connection way and to investigate all the types' addition & remodeling ways. The study used literature research method, analysing the digital images, the annotation of the images, official documents between the Japanese government-general of Korea and To, and articles of newspapers or journals. The site-plans are sorted 5 types and subdivided 13 as their addition & remodelling ways. The initial shapes of site-plan were changed to apply every Goon's site circumstances, The main buildings were always in the center ahead and attached buildings behind or next to them in any cases of new construction, addition or remodeling. The buildings of the common design's were constructed until early 1930s and it means that their architectural level was lower than Pu office buildings, although both had same administrational level.

  • Quantitative analysis of the number of construction workers and construction period can present a new standard for appropriate personnel. This study presents a Queueing model that predicts the execution time of work procedures, the most important factor among work efficiency indicators. During the working cycle of apartment frame construction the same process tends to be repeated the volume of contruction. Based on these characteristics, this study used a Queueing Model and analyzed reference layer cycle of the delayed frame construction. After adjusting the number of people and the construction period, the performance of the model was analyzed and suggested. This study aims to support the decision making of personnel distribution according to the volume of construction by performing a performance analysis of the Queueing Model.

  • In the scripture of Daesoon Jinrihoe, the expression 'Dosu (度數)' is frequently used and Jeungsan, Jeongsan, and Wudang also left behind many teachings related to Dosu. In this paper, the concept of Dosu is analyzed in detail and the achievement of an in-depth understanding of the concept of Dosu is attempted. The term Dosu is often used in traditional literature. In the classics, Dosu was used to mean institutions, standards, rules, law, figures, and the laws of heavenly bodies. In other words, Dosu is used to mean the laws of astronomy and the norms of human society. This meaning is expanded and used as the principle of the universe and nature. This concept of Dosu is related to the mathematical cosmological understanding of numbers as the principle of the universe. This type of mathematical cosmology was systematized by Shao Yong (邵雍). In the Joseon Dynasty, Seo Gyungduk (徐敬德) accepted it positively, and it thereby became an influential trend in Korean thought. In the world view of Daesoon thought, there exists the view that numbers as a principle of the universe, and of course this world view is connected to mathematical cosmology. In Daesoon thought, the concept of Dosu is based on the concept of traditional Dosu and adds an additional meaning which connects it to the Reordering of the Universe (Cheonjigongsa). Also, Dosu is used to mean the process of changing the principles and laws of cosmos through Jeungsan's Reordering of the Universe. It is especially the case that discourse about Dosu is widely used when describing the Reordering of the Universe. Jeungsan corrected, reorganized, and adjusted Dosu, as well as establishing new Dosu. Jeongsan, who succeeded Jeungsan, followed the Reordering of the Universe by Jeungsan, and also realized Dosu. In other words, Jeongsan acted and practiced according to the Dosu that had been enacted by Jeungsan. Also, Dosu means the process of the transformation of principle according to the Reordering of the Universe, and Wudang used the concept of Dosu to describe the historical process of Daesoon Jinrihoe. This means that the foundation of Mugeukdo, the change to Taegukdo, the establishment of Daesoon Jinrihoe, and the contruction of Yeoju headquarters are episodes in a divine history carried out through Dosu. Through this discourse, Daesoon Jinrihoe asserts a legitimacy that distinguishes itself from other sects, and believers can be inspired by the sacred meaning that they are participating in the Dosu of heaven and earth. This empowers their devotion and sincerity.
